Live Onsite Real Estate Auction with Internet Bidding 6BR Custom Home on 3.64 Acres

With high-end finishes and thoughtful details throughout, this home offers the space you need for a growing family, effortless entertaining, or multi-generational living.

99 Fogelsanger Road, Shippensburg PA 17257

Important Dates

Property Open House: Saturday, April 11th 2-4pm
Live Auction Date: Tuesday, April 21st @ 6pm

Property Highlights:

  • 6 Bedrooms / 3 Full Bathrooms / 2 Half Bathrooms
  • 3 Car Garage
  • 3.64 Acres
  • Granite Countertops, SS Appliances, Kitchen Island, Breakfast Nook
  • Primary En Suite w/ Updated Bathroom (2022)
  • In-Law Suite w/ Accessibility Features plus Elevator
  • 16’ Vaulted Ceilings & Dual Sided Fireplace
  • Fenced Pasture w/ Electric & Water
  • Hay Shed, Chicken Yard, & Additional Outbuilding
  • Wraparound Three-Season Porch
  • Full Basement w/ 400 Sq Ft Workshop w/ Lighting & Electric
  • Heat Pump w/ Central A/C
  • Walking Distance to Shippensburg University
  • Well / Public Sewer
  • Close to Cumberland Valley Rail Trail and Appalachian Trail
  • Shippensburg Area Schools
  • Total Taxes: $8,460/yr

Who We Are

The Franklin County Free Press, established by Vicky Taylor in 2019, emerged as a beacon of local journalism for the residents of Franklin County. Under Vicky's leadership, it quickly became an essential source of news, particularly at a time when major newspaper publications were increasingly overlooking local coverage.

On January 1, 2022, the torch was passed to Nathan Neil and his firm, Neil Publishing, LLC. Neil, a local entrepreneur with multiple thriving businesses in Chambersburg, shares Vicky's fervent commitment to both the community and the world of local journalism.

Rooted in the heart of Franklin County and powered by its residents, the Franklin County Free Press continues to bridge the gap, ensuring that the local stories, events, and issues that matter most to the community remain in the spotlight.
